Unraveling the Layers within News

In today's information-saturated landscape, comprehending news requires a discerning approach. A single article can be a tapestry woven with varied perspectives, subtextual agendas, and dynamic contexts. To truly absorb the narrative, we must delve through the surface layer of facts and scrutinize the layers that intertwine the whole.

  • Consider the platform of the information: who is delivering it and what are their possible biases?
  • Examine the language used: are there subtle messages or persuasive techniques at play?
  • Seek for corroborating facts from credible outlets to determine the validity of the claims.

By developing a critical mind, we can traverse the complexities of news and emerge a more nuanced insight of the world around us.

Beyond in Headlines: Deeper Information Analysis

In a world saturated with information, it's crucial to move past the headlines and delve into deeper news analysis. While mainstream media often provides short summaries of events, true understanding requires examination of the underlying influences. By critically evaluating sources, identifying perspectives, and evaluating diverse viewpoints, we can cultivate a more comprehensive grasp of complex situations.

  • To achieve this level of understanding, it's essential to hone critical thinking skills.
  • This demands the ability to challenge information, detect patterns, and draw independent conclusions.
